Dhaka, Sept 8, 2026 (BSS) - A court here today granted two days’ remand to 22-year-old Rahat Hossain in a case filed over the alleged abetment of the suicide of his 16-year-old wife Afra Khan in the DIT Plot area of Shyampur here.
Dhaka Metropolitan Magistrate Mahbub Alam granted the remand after a hearing as the investigating officer sought a seven-day remand for Rahat.
Police arrested Rahat from his residence at DIT Plot in Shyampur on August 21. The following day, he was sent to jail.
According to the case statement, Rahat and Afra got married on May 8 in a family-arranged marriage. Since their marriage, Rahat had allegedly used obscene and abusive language against Afra over various issues.
On August 20, Rahat’s mother Sonia Akter informed the victim’s mother over the phone that Afra had fallen unconscious. Rahat’s father Liton Bepari and elder brother Saif Hossain took Afra to a local hospital in Sutrapur.
Victim’s mother went to the hospital and found marks of injuries on her daughter’s body.
Afra was subsequently referred to Dhaka Medical College Hospital where the attending physician declared her dead.
Following the incident, her mother Lucky Akter filed a case with Shyampur Police Station on August 20 against four people, including Rahat.
The other three accused are Rahat’s mother Sonia Akter, father Liton Bepari and elder brother Saif Hossain.
